' This is an application by Fateh Muhammad and Muhammad Ashraf for grant of bail. They, are accused of liences under section 302/307/34, P.P.C. And are said to have a dispute over some lard with Muhammad Tufail deceased. On the night of the occurrence they went to the Karkhana where the deceased used to sleep her workers were also present there. Muhammad Ashraf petitioner was arr ied with a pistol while (Alai) co-accused was armed with a sten-gun. Imme, liately after their arrival Muhammad Ashraf petitioner took out his pistil I but Allah Rakha complainant, the brother of the deceased, caught hold of him from his wrist. Muhammad Ashraf petitioner shouted to his friends for help, whereupon Gulab co-accused came in with his sten-gun. Lie tried to shoot at Muhammad Tufail deceased but the sten-gun got stuck. Thereupon Muhammad Ashraf petitioner who had in the meanwhile been caught hold of by Allah Rakha and Muhammad "Tufail threw his pistol towards Gulab co-accused, who fired a shot with it which hit the right elbow of Allah Rakha complainant. At this juncture Fetch Muhammad petitioner also came in and raised lalkara saying that Muhammad Tufail (deceased) should not be left alive. Gulab co-accused fired another shot with the pistol which missed and instead of hitting Muhammad Tufail hit a nearby wall.
Muhammad Ashraf, Gulab and Fateh Muhammad then caught hold of Muhammad Tufail (deceased) and Gulab struck him with the butt of the sten-gun hitting him on the left temple and nose. Thereafter they ran away. GAM:, co-accused left his sten-gun at the place which was taken into possession by the witnesses.
2. The learned counsel for the petitioners submitted that all the injuries are attributed to Gulab co- accused, and that Fateh Muhammad, who is real brother of Gulab, was admitted empty handed and as such did not 4 cause any injury, to anyone. He submitted that he has been involved merely because he is related to the ins in accused.
' He does not press the application with regard to Muhammad Ashraf petitioner and I think he is right in doing so because an overt act has been attributed to him. He was armed with a pistol with which he tried to shoot at Muhammad Tufail (deceased), but was prevented because Allah Rakha complainant had in the meanwhile caught hold of his wrist where after he had no option but to pass over his pistol to Gulag whose sten-gun had got stuck.
3. The result is that only Fetch Muhammad petitioner is granted bail in the sum of Rs, 15,000 (Rupees fifteen thousand) with two sureties each in the like amount to the satisfaction of the Assistant Commissioner, Gujranwala.
